HHS’s Adara Donald Meets With Tennessee Senator Dolores Gresham

From February 6-9, Haywood High School’s Adara Donald attended a Youth Government Citizenship seminar, along with the State Officers from the seven Career and Technical Student Organizations (CTSOs): FCCLA (Family, Career and Community Leaders of America), SkillsUSA, HOSA (Health Occupations Student Association), FBLA (Future Business Leaders of America), DECA, FFA (Future Farmers of America), and TSA (Technology Student Association). Adara serves as the Tennessee FCCLA Vice President of Individual Development. At this seminar, State officers for CTSOs learn advocacy skills that they took to the field when they met with their legislators on February 9. Adara met Senator Dolores Gresham and advocated for Career and Technical Education and Career and Technical Student Organizations.
